Prova nya appar, funktioner och IAP:er på din iPhone gratis innan de finns i App Store
Tro det eller ej, det finns legitima iOS-appar utanför App Store som du kan installera på din iPhone. Vissa av dem fungerar till och med för iPad, Apple TV och Mac, och deras användning har också fördelar jämfört med apparna som finns i App Store.
Alla kommer inte att vilja prova dessa appar eftersom de alla är i betatestning. Om du tycker om att använda iOS-betas på din iPhone från Apple-utvecklare och offentliga betaprogram, kommer du förmodligen att njuta av att testa betaappar från tredjepartsutvecklare. Det bästa av allt är att allt är tillgängligt på Apples TestFlight- apptestplattform, vilket betyder att du inte gör något som Apple inte godkänner.
TestFlight är öppet för alla utvecklare som vill dela tidiga appuppdateringar och få värdefull feedback från betaanvändare innan de görs tillgängliga för massorna i App Store. Välkända appar som Discord, Facebook, Messenger, Signal, Snapchat, Spotify, Telegram och WhatsApp är bara några av de du kan installera, och var och en av dem ger dig tillgång till nya funktioner och verktyg före alla andra.
Varför du bör använda TestFlight
Den största anledningen till att använda TestFlight är att ge värdefull feedback till utvecklare för att hjälpa till att fixa buggar, stryka ut nya funktioner och på annat sätt testa dina appar innan du skickar in dem till App Store för granskning. Du kan till och med rekommendera nya funktioner. Det är som att du är en del av själva utvecklingsteamet, där du hjälper till att vägleda utvecklingen av appen för alla andra. Andra skäl inkluderar:
Användning av nya applikationer inför allmänheten
Vissa applikationer i TestFlight har precis börjat utvecklas. Med din feedback kan du hjälpa utvecklare att få sin första stabila app på App Store.
Användning av nya funktioner i applikationer före allmänheten
Några av apparna i TestFlight har funnits i App Store ett tag, men de använder fortfarande betaversioner för att testa nya funktioner för framtida appuppdateringar.
Använder exklusiva betafunktioner i appar
Vissa appar i TestFlight använder experimentella funktioner som med största sannolikhet aldrig kommer in i den stabila konstruktionen. Funktioner kanske inte uppfyller kvalitetsstandarder, vara ogillade av betatesters, användas för att uppmuntra användare att betatesta sin app eller avvisas under App Store-granskningen.
Till exempel kan en utvecklare implementera prefs:root URL-scheman som öppnar vissa appmenyer i Inställningar, men Apple överväger dessa privata URL-scheman och avvisar inlämning till App Store på grund av att de innehåller icke-offentliga URL-scheman. Som ett annat exempel inkluderar e-postklienten Spark läskvitton i TestFlight-betan, men inte och planerar inte att inkludera dem i någon appuppdatering.
Läsrapporter finns tillgängliga i Spark TestFlight-applikationen.
Få köp i appen gratis
Enligt Apple utvärderar vissa appar i TestFlight funktioner som finns i köp i appar (IAP) för att säkerställa att deras appar och servrar ”korrekt hanterar vanliga köpscenarier såsom prenumerationserbjudanden, avbrutna köp eller återbetalningar.” Alla IAP:er är inte tillgängliga i TestFlight appar, så tänk på det.
Inköp i appen i TestFlight använder en sandlådemiljö, så de är gratis för testare och överförs inte till produktion när appen väl har släppts på App Store.
Även om den kostnadsfria IAP inte kommer att porteras till den stabila versionen av App Store, kan du fortfarande prova den för att se om du vill köpa den i framtiden. Dessutom, om du fortsätter med betatestning, kan detta vara en av de längsta gratis IAP-testversioner du kan få om inte utvecklaren tar bort den från TestFlight-bygget.
Vissa IAP:er är tillgängliga gratis i TestFlight-apparna, men inte alla.
Enheter som kan användas med TestFlight betaappar
Du kan installera TestFlight på iPhone, iPad, iPod touch, Apple TV och Mac via App Store . Mac-stöd är det senaste i gänget och har bara stötts sedan 3 november 2021.
- Installera: TestFlight från App Store (gratis)
För att installera och använda betaappar från tredje part från TestFlight-plattformen måste dina enheter köra följande operativsystem.
- iPhone eller iPod touch: iOS 13 eller senare (iOS 14 eller senare för appklipp)
- iPad: iPadOS 13 eller senare (iPadOS 14 eller senare för App Clips)
- Apple Watch: watchOS 6 eller senare
- Apple TV: tvOS 13 eller senare
- Mac: macOS 12 Monterey eller senare
Hur man hittar TestFlight Beta-appar
För att installera betaappar från tredje part måste du hitta och acceptera TestFlight-länken eller inbjudningskoden för var och en. Vissa länkar och koder kan hittas i det offentliga området från utvecklare. Andra kan du få från utvecklarna efter att ha begärt tillgång till betan. Att hitta eller skaffa en TestFlight-länk eller kod är inte alltid lätt, så jag har satt ihop en lista över sätt du kan hitta dem på.
För något av alternativen nedan kan du se att betaappen är full eller inte accepterar nya testare. Betaappar genom TestFlight är begränsade till 10 000 användare, vilket kan fyllas snabbt, särskilt för mer populära appar. Utvecklare kan också sätta sina egna gränser baserat på mängden och typen av input de vill ha.
Viktigt: du kan inte behålla den stabila och betaversionen av applikationen
Tyvärr kan du inte installera betaversionen av TestFlight-appen och behålla den stabila versionen av App Store på din enhet. Om du vill installera betaversionen kommer den att ersätta versionen från App Store. När du tittar på appen i App Store, kommer under ”Hämta”-ikonen att indikera vilken betaversion du har, med en länk att se i TestFlight-appen. Om du ”skaffar” appen från App Store kommer den att ersätta betaversionen.
TestFlight Betas Genväg Gadget Hacks
Vi har skapat en genväg som ger TestFlight-länkar till över 30 populära appar. Om du inte ser appen du vill betatesta i listan kan du söka, som hittar appen i App Store, få dess nuvarande namn, söka på Google för att se om den har en TestFlight-länk och sedan öppna länken till höger i TestFlight.
Så här använder du etiketten:
- Installera genvägen Gadget Hacks TestFlight Betas .
- Tryck på genvägskortet i Mitt bibliotek i appen Genvägar.
- Välj en app från listan om du ser den där så tas du till betaappen i TestFlight.
- Om betan är öppen för nya testare, klicka på ”Acceptera” för att installera appen.
Om du inte ser appen du vill ha:
- Bläddra istället till botten av listan och klicka på ”Hitta fler TestFlight-länkar”.
- Gå in i App Store-appen du vill söka efter.
- Välj rätt app från resultaten, om tillgänglig, så kommer du att dirigeras till betaappen i TestFlight. Om den inte hittar appen kommer den att säga ”TestFlight-appen hittades inte för [appnamn]”.
- Om betan är öppen för nya testare, klicka på ”Acceptera” för att installera appen.
Avgångar
Departures.to är en bra sida för att hitta länkar till TestFlight. Dess hemsida visar de senaste öppna betaversionerna som skickats in av Departures community, och du kan söka i webbplatsens databas efter andra applikationer.
När du väljer en app ser du dess status (öppen, full eller stängd), när dess status ändrades, när appen lades till i indexet och när dess status senast kontrollerades av ursprungstjänster. För att komma åt betaappen, klicka på knappen ”Öppna i TestFlight”.
Dessutom kan du skicka in TestFlight-länkar till Departures om du upptäcker att en av dem saknas i dess databas. För att göra detta, klicka på ” Lägg upp länk ” högst upp på sidan (klicka först på menyikonen om du inte ser länken att skicka in) och fyll i formuläret.
Lista över Awesome TestFlight-appar (GitHub)
Listan över Awesome TestFlight-appar på GitHub som underhålls av pluwen innehåller en hel del länkar till TestFlight. Förvaret uppdateras regelbundet och innehåller några av de mest populära applikationerna. Listan visar om en beta, full eller stängd är tillgänglig, men dessa statusar är vanligtvis föråldrade och felaktiga.
Länkar till TestFlight (Google Sheets)
Kalkylarket TestFlight Links Google Sheets skapades av Reddit-användare på r/TestFlight subreddit . Den har en lista med 250+ TestFlight-länkar. Precis som GitHub-listan kommer du att se om betaversioner är tillgängliga, kompletta eller stängda, och den är vanligtvis också föråldrad eller felaktig.
TestFlight List av WABetaInfo
WABetaInfo är en webbplats som främst täcker WhatsApp beta-nyheter men som även publicerar TestFlight-länkar för andra betaappar. Du kan bläddra eller söka i listan, sortera listan i alfabetisk ordning eller efter nyligen tillagda, taggade, gamla eller ämnen som har TestFlight-länkar. Du kommer att se om utvecklaren stängt sin beta och när den senaste sloten var tillgänglig. Det kommer också att visa dig när betan är öppen eller det finns ett formulär du kan fylla i för att begära åtkomst.
Flygplats
Liksom Departures är Airport ett annat projekt byggt specifikt för att vara värd för betaapparna som finns tillgängliga i TestFlight. Det liknar App Store, men för TestFlight betaappar, där utvecklare skickar in sina appar för publicering och upptäckt. De flesta AirPort-utvecklare är oberoende utvecklare.
Du kan använda Airport Web App för att söka efter och visa TestFlight-betas i din webbläsare, men du måste logga in på tjänsten med Logga in med Apple för att få länkar till TestFlight. När du har loggat in klickar du på ”Hämta” för att öppna betan i TestFlight.
Det finns också flygplatsens egen betaapp för iOS , men den är endast inbjudan på TestFlight, så du måste begära åtkomst. Efter att ha fått åtkomst kommer installationsprocessen att vara densamma som i webbapplikationen.
Live testflyg
TestFlight Live är väldigt lik flygplatsens webbapp. Webbplatsen tillåter utvecklare att skicka in appar till den, och de flesta betaversioner kommer från oberoende utvecklare. För att installera en app från TestFlight Live, klicka på appen du vill installera och sedan på ”Hämta”.
Testflyg X
TestFlight X är ett Twitter-konto eller Telegram- grupp som delar länkar till TestFlight. Det här är ett bra sätt att få meddelanden om nyligen öppnade appar. Till exempel, om en slot är öppen i TestFlight-betan i Twitter-appen, kommer kontot att lägga upp en länk för att meddela dig att den är tillgänglig. Han delar också med sig av nya länkar till TestFlight-appen.
Möjliga fel med länkar till TestFlight beta-appen
När du använder länkar kan du se några popup-fönster eller fel. Detta beror på att TestFlight-appar regleras annorlunda än App Store-appar.
Du kan se meddelandet ”Denna beta accepterar inte nya testare för närvarande”, vilket betyder att utvecklaren tillfälligt har inaktiverat nya betatestare. Det kan också betyda att de inte har något betatest för appen just nu.
En annan popup kan säga ”Denna beta är full”, vilket betyder att betan antingen har nått det maximala antalet testare som tillåts av Apple (10 000) eller satt av utvecklaren.
Hur man installerar TestFlight Beta-appar
När du väl hittar länken är det mycket enkelt att installera betaappen. Öppna bara länken, klicka på ”Acceptera” och sedan på ”Installera”. Om du accepterar men inte installerar den, kommer betan fortfarande att dyka upp i ditt TestFlight-bibliotek som accepterad. Installerade betaappar visas på startskärmen eller i appbiblioteket, beroende på dina inställningar.
Om det finns en betaapp i ditt TestFlight-bibliotek som du har accepterat men ännu inte installerat, kan du klicka på ”Installera” bredvid dess namn i ditt TestFlight-bibliotek eller efter att ha öppnat TestFlight-betabeskrivningen.
Hur man uppdaterar TestFlight betaappar
TestFlight betaappar uppdateras på samma sätt som stabila appar uppdateras i App Store. Det finns dock några skillnader som är värda att notera.
För att uppdatera appen, öppna TestFlight och klicka på knappen Uppdatera. Om du vill uppdatera alla dina appar samtidigt är det enda sättet att göra det genom att trycka och hålla ned TestFlight-ikonen på din startskärm eller appbibliotek och trycka på Uppdatera alla från snabbåtgärdsmenyn.
Du kan också aktivera ”Automatiska uppdateringar” per app genom att öppna betaappens beskrivning i ditt TestFlight-bibliotek och aktivera alternativet. Den här funktionen fungerar dock inte hela tiden och ibland måste du uppdatera dina appar manuellt.
Hur man rapporterar buggar till utvecklare av TestFlight betaapp
En av de fantastiska sakerna med TestFlight är att du kan rapportera irriterande buggar. För att skicka en apprapport, öppna TestFlight, tryck på appen du vill skicka feedback för och välj sedan Skicka betafeedback. Alternativt, tryck och håll ned betaappikonen på hemskärmen eller appbiblioteket och välj ”Skicka betafeedback” från Snabbåtgärder.
Därefter kommer du att ha möjlighet att lägga till en skärmdump. Om du inte har gjort det ännu och vill, gå tillbaka till appen och gör en, gå sedan tillbaka och välj Aktivera skärmdump. Genom att välja om du har en skärmdump kan du skriva till utvecklaren och berätta exakt vad som händer med felet.
Feedbackrapporten kommer att visas i utvecklarens App Store Connect-instrumentpanel. Tänk på att om du skickar en rapport till en utvecklare skickas diagnostiska loggar och enhetsinformation.
När din iPhone upptäcker en betaappkrasch frågar den dig också om du vill skicka in en kraschrapport.
Hur man nedgraderar TestFlight Beta-appar
En annan unik sak du kan göra är att nedgradera dina TestFlight-appar. Detta är användbart om du hittar ett stort problem med den senaste betaversionen, till exempel en krasch eller en funktion som inte svarar.
För att gå till en tidigare version, öppna appbeskrivningen i TestFlight. Om en tidigare version är tillgänglig för appen kommer den att visas i avsnittet Appinformation precis före avsnittet Utvecklare. Hitta sedan versionen du vill uppgradera till, klicka på Installera och bekräfta.
Du kan även nedgradera (eller uppgradera, beroende på hur du ser på det) den stabila versionen av appen i App Store. Sök bara efter det i App Store och klicka på ”Hämta”.
Vanliga buggar och klagomål med TestFlight
Att använda TestFlight har många nackdelar. Inte bara är det fullt av buggar, utan TestFlight är inte designat för att fungera med ett stort antal applikationer.
Kända buggar med TestFlight:
- Ibland laddas appen inte särskilt snabbt. Andra gånger laddas den inte alls. Om detta händer, tvångsavsluta TestFlight. För att göra detta sveper du uppåt i hemfältet eller dubbeltrycker på hemknappen och sveper sedan uppåt på appkortet. Ibland fungerar ”Try Again”-knappen, men jag har inte haft så mycket tur med det. Som alla Apple-tjänster går TestFlight-servrar ner då och då, men du kan kontrollera deras status på webbsidan Apple System Status .
- Ibland fungerar inte snabbåtgärden ”Uppdatera alla” första gången du klickar på den. Jag brukar trycka på knappen två eller tre gånger innan den äntligen uppdaterar alla mina appar.
Klagomål om TestFlight:
- TestFlight har ingen sökfunktion. Du kan inte söka efter nya betaappar att lägga till, och du kan inte ens söka efter en betaapp som du har accepterat eller installerat. Genom att söka på startskärmen eller appbiblioteket kan det finnas en betaapp, men den skiljer den inte från App Store-appar.
- Betaappar som du lägger till från TestFlight kan återkalla din åtkomst av många anledningar. Om de gör det kommer du inte längre att kunna installera dem. Orsaker inkluderar betaversioner som löper ut efter 90-dagarsperioden, utvecklare som tar bort appar från TestFlight eller utvecklare som tar bort användare från sin testlista. Vissa utvecklare har varit kända för att ta bort inaktiva användare, inklusive men inte begränsat till Snapchat, Facebook, Firefox, 1Password, Spotify och TikTok. Du kan lägga till betan tillbaka via dess inbjudningslänk om det händer.
- Som nämnts ovan begränsar Apple antalet testare som kan gå med i betaappen till 10 000 personer. Om det är en populär app kommer platserna att fyllas upp snabbt och det kan ta lite tid innan du kan få åtkomst.
Lämna ett svar